Giovanni Migliara: A Milanese Visionary Giovanni Migliara (October 15, 1785 – April 18, 1837) was a nobleman and Italian painter born in Alexandria, Italy. Despite his humble beginnings—his parents were artisans with limited means—Migliara’s prodigious talent propelled him to prominence within the burgeoning artistic landscape of early 19th century Milanese society.
